Other features include:

  • Photo gallery: Upload photos of your pets and see photos of other pets in the community.
  • Video galley: Upload fun videos of your pets and see what others upload as well.
  • Friends: Like Facebook, on The Pet Community you can request the friendship of other animals. If you get a friend request you can accept or decline it. You will receive an email each time you get a friend request, but you can also disable notifications.
  • Blog posts: Write blog posts to share adventures with your pets.
  • Recent events: On your side bar and on the bottom of the home page you can see recent activity. This tells you when someone logged in, created a new pet profile or uploaded media.
  • Photo contests: The Pet Community will be hosting photo contests. That feature is coming soon!
  • Celebrity pets: There are celebrity pets that you can follow on The Pet Community, including Nala Cat, Cole & Marmalade, and now Wynston!
  • All pets welcome: Have a ferret, rabbit, horse or reptile? All animals are welcome on The Pet Community!
  • Forums: Discuss anything pet related. All pets are included – from dogs and cats to reptiles and small animals!
